TIGER Excellence scholarship for incoming mobility in M2 AI4PH

Aix-Marseille University has made international mobility and the reception of international students one of the pillars of its attractiveness policy. It has set up a unique system of scholarships to finance outstanding students who wish to enrol at the university.
 

 

What is a TIGER Excellence Scholarship for incoming mobility?

The M2 incoming mobility grant for the AI4PH specialization of the Public Health Masters enables you to follow this course in Marseille. It includes :

  • €10,000 / year.
  • Guaranteed residential accommodation (subject to completing the necessary formalities in good time).
  • A personalised support and installation service on arrival in France.

 

How much is the scholarship?

Aix-Marseille Université will fund you up to €10,000 for one academic year.

 

Can the scholarship be cumulative?

The scholarship can be combined with other schemes (government grants, work placement bonuses, outgoing mobility grants, etc.) up to a maximum of €2,000 per month (the student must declare his or her resources in the commitment contract).

 

Who can apply?

This M2 scholarship is aimed at international students who are not French nationals and who have never been enrolled in a French establishment, whose past and current university studies show excellent results attested by a good academic record, and who are enrolling in M2 AI4PH specialization of the Public Health Masters. Only face-to-face mobility is eligible.

 

Who carries out the selection process?

These grants are awarded by a committee made up of lecturers from the AI4PH specialization of the Masters in Public Health.
